MLB player casually scratches his head while a live ball is caught feet away

Maybe Adeiny Hechavarria is very confident in Martin Prado’s ability to field a popup. So much so that he stopped to admire Prado on this play. Not only did he let Prado take control, but he paused to scratch his head during the play. When you have an itch, you have an itch.

Or maybe Hechavarria took throwing shade to a whole new level. As the shortstop, Hechavarria has authority to call off anyone on a popup. But in this case Prado, the third baseman, took control. Hechavarria let him have the popup this time, but made sure to let everyone know it was such a curious decision he had to scratch his head.

This whole situation is a real head scratcher.
